Fuji Apple Spice Cake with Cream Cheese Frosting
Ingredients
3 cups all purpose flour 1 3/4 teaspoons ground cinnamon 1 1/2 teaspoons baking powder 1/2 teaspoon salt 1/2 teaspoon ground allspice 1/4 teaspoon freshly grated nutmeg or ground nutmeg 1/4 teaspoon baking soda 1 cup (2 sticks) unsalted butter, room temperature 1 1/4 cups sugar 3/4 cup (packed) golden brown sugar 3 large eggs 2 teaspoons vanilla extract 2 tablespoons bourbon, apple brandy, or rum (optional) 1 1/2 cups unsweetened applesauce 2 medium Fuji or Gala apples (13 to 14 ounces total), peeled, halved, cored, cut into 1/3-inch cubes 1 1/2 cups finely chopped pecans (about 6 ounces) Frosting: - 1 8-ounce package cream cheese, room temperature
- 1/2 cup (1 stick) unsalted butter, room temperature
- 1 tablespoon vanilla extract
- Pinch of salt
- 3 cups powdered sugar (measured, then sifted)
- Coarsely chopped toasted pecans (for garnish)
- Special equipment: 2 9-inch-diameter cake pans with 2-inch-high sides
